Sport last Week, Part 2/3

England's Jess Carter kicks the ball ahead of Spain's Esther Gonzalez during the Women's Euro 2025 final soccer match between England and Spain at St. Jakob-Park in Basel, Switzerland, Sunday, July 27, 2025. (Photo by Michael Probst/AP Photo)
Sport last Week, Part 2/3
   
  Military Woman Gallery

Must See Places

Google Ads Privacy